The Romanian capital market set new all-time highs in terms of liquidity in 2022, a year marked by volatility and uncertainties.
The Bucharest Stock Exchange (BVB) reached a new record in 2022 in terms of the total value of transactions carried out on all markets with all types of financial instruments - RON 24 billion (EUR 4.9 bln), up 11% compared to 2021 when this value was RON 21.6 billion. In the equity segment, the total value of transactions reached almost RON 13.5 billion (EUR 2.75 bln), up 17% year-on-year.
